#48752d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#48752d is composed of 28.2% red, 45.9%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.5%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 97.5 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 31.8%. #48752d color hex could be obtained by blending #90ea5a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#48752d color description : Dark moderate green.
#48752d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#48752d has RGB values of R:72, G:117,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 4748589.
